Transaction cae907821bb69daed853cba7e35d4aac9d79acf3ddcbe98307d3259c058a2417

1 Input
2 Outputs
  • cae907821bb69daed853cba7e35d4aac9d79acf3ddcbe98307d3259c058a2417:0
  • value  720000
    address  17pFnZ5fybidQvR7XxEAWVW5yH2Zf9NfyY
  • cae907821bb69daed853cba7e35d4aac9d79acf3ddcbe98307d3259c058a2417:1
  • value  22912931
    address  195cDEvDR4S6vVm8WZZZWFNg28aCFknFPf